Yeah, I did project $51.5M for the 2nd weekend for an actual number, still off by a smidge. I have been looking at this film's box office sales and even last week after looking at things thoroughly, I saw a 69% drop coming which is pretty much exactly what happened. Am I surprised? No, not at all. What does it mean for WB? Well, it means you were damn close to 70% really. Any executive who tries to play this off as simply insignificant needs to re-evaluate the situation.

I will not be changing my projection since opening weekend and that is a rather low domestic haul of $330 million and $880 million globally. Take a look at the company of films surrounding BvS on the all-time domestic list and it makes one wonder what could have been if the film simply had better WOM and a higher RT score and maybe an 'A' CinemaScore to boot. If I am WB, I'm going to pull a Hunger Games and not release another film in March whether it be a solo superhero movie or joint/team up film.

DC will not be going bankrupt. There is still money out there to be earned. As far as box office goes, yes, they may barely break even or come short of where they want to be but there is still other revenue sources to be made that will put it in the green. Unless you work for DC, WB, or are an insider who knows people, you don't truly know their financial situation. Its a lot more complicated than you and a lot of other people could fathom.

Now, with regards to box office, this film just doesn't have the legs to compete for the next month or two. I said from the beginning, if BvS can remain in the box office for at least 100+ days, the domestic take will be higher but if we look back at Man of Steel, it was only in the box office for 98 days. That is alarming to me, and it looks as though BvS is heading down that same path.

People might wonder what causes a movie to have such a short release term? Its simple: poor critic reviews, mixed audience reactions = poor word of mouth. These three factors always determine whether a film will have 'legs' during its release in the box office.
